Meet Opie
FOSTERED IN: Chicago, IL 60609
ESTIMATED DOB: 09/2019
COLOR/BREED: Tabby Shorthair
GENDER: Male
KIDS: Possible
DOGS: Yes
CATS: Yes
HISTORY:
Opie and another cat were found in an area frequently visited by strays and ferals. When the caretaker realized how nice these two boys were she looked to find indoor placement for them.
ABOUT:
Opie is very sweet and loves attention from people, he’s the kind of cat that doesn’t have a no-touch zone. He even enjoys belly rubs. Opie loves to be held and lets his foster mom hold him like a baby. If you are touching him and loving him, you can do whatever the heck you want! Opie has met visiting children once, but because he usually needs a day or two to warm up to new people he didn’t interact with them at all. We think Opie will do fine with gentle children who love to give pets. Because Opie can be a little timid in new situations we think a more predictable, calm home will be the best fit for him. Despite being a bit timid at times, Opie is also very curious and likes to explore his home and watch the world through the windows. Opie is a pretty chill guy who isn’t terribly active and mostly just loves to snuggle and take naps. Opie enjoys playing for a bit each day and he likes the laser pointer and anything with catnip. Opie gets along very well with the small dog in his foster home, and would likely do well with other cats.
